Puppy (6 - 9mths), Junior (9 - 18mths), Intermediate (15 - 24mths), Veteran (8yrs+), Open (15mths+), Working (15mths+), Champion (15mths+)
NB - At this show, the decisive date in respect of age is the day of the show.
Working Class: Qualifications to be attached to entry. Dogs must have attained a minimum of one of the following: Class A Obedience, CD, IPO 'I' or Breed Working Test with at least 75% marks |
Breeders Challenge: Minimum 3, maximum 5 exhibits of the same breed and variety, without distinction of sex, bred by the same persons, even if they are no longer owned by the Breeder(s). One entry form to be submitted per family reflecting Breeder's name, Kennel name, Breed, and proof of payment. |

RULES |
SPECIAL INSTRUCTIONS |
NB: Judging will take place in accordance with FCI Group Listings and according to FCI breed standards.
CACIB - only dogs graded "EXCELLENT", awarded 1st place (being over the age of 15 mths on the day before the show) from the Intermediate, Open, Working and Champions classes are eligible to compete for CACIB
Best of Breed - competed for by Junior Dog & Bitch winners plus Veteran Dog & Bitch winners (all having been graded "EXCELLENT") plus CACIB Dog & Bitch winners (ie. potentially 6 dogs)
Best Puppy - Only Puppies, placed with a "VERY PROMISING" grading, may compete for Best Puppy.
